Voter Registration Deadline in OC is Midnight For the Nov. 6 Election


Tick tock.

Citizens anxious to boot President Barack Obama from the White House (or to keep Mitt Romney out of it), but haven't yet registered to vote for the Nov. 6 election face a midnight deadline today to fill out the necessary, brief paperwork for the Orange County Registrar of Voters.

The Obama-Romney showdown could be the closest election in U.S. History, so make your voice heard.
The Registrar's Soviet-bunker style office is located at 1300 South Grand Avenue, Building C, at the intersection of Grand Ave. and McFadden in Santa Ana.

]

To secure a valid registration, you must be a non-felon, U.S. citizen over 18 years old who is a California resident.  
For voting questions, go to www.ocvote.com.
